Why are men's clothes so much nicer than women's?

7 replies

BansheeofInisherin · 10/06/2023 21:13

Today I went on a mission to find some light summer tshirts on the high street ( or what remains of it). I wanted:
V neck
100% cotton
Cap or half sleeves
Deep solids rather than pale pink, blue or yellow which don't suit me. Not black or white; have those already
Not floral
Not cropped but not oversize either. Just regular size.

The only place I could find all this was in the men's section at Uniqlo, where I bought 3 Supima cotton tees in the XS. I could have bought more. The colours were lovely in the men's. In the women's, it was all dusty pink, muted blue and white or black. Or cropped.

MadamPia · 22/09/2023 16:35

Because they make them less fast. Women’s are clothes are made in the masses and often to make lots of cheap clothing you have to sew quick, and the less features you have the quicker and simplify it is to make a garment.

Have you noticed women barely get as many pockets and we tend to have lots of stretch cheap fabrics instead of well made woven materials like men’s clothing?

Its because it’s made cheap and fast to catch up to stupid demand.

You can find well made women’s clothing, just not from stores with hundreds of samples. You will just have to pay a little more.
